Output 5db8cdfa30571c98010509a30b46da2607fed91917c552c39fd80cfda7d9831e:3

value
22359341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df3e13ba4d0276cd4494cf7eb2f6633694e93044 OP_EQUAL
address
MUFZHQ3roN4C5KLYzJGqYDfRBDo3z792G7
transaction
5db8cdfa30571c98010509a30b46da2607fed91917c552c39fd80cfda7d9831e
spent
true